Freshman Football Squad Suffered Another Injury

A new injury was added to the long hospital list of the Freshman squad yesterday when it was discovered that Trainer, a substitute back, who was injured in the Dean game last Saturday, had suffered a broken ankle.

The Freshmen scrimmaged very poorly yesterday, and their listlessness was discouraging in view of the way they played last Saturday. Playing against the University second team they carried the ball to the five-yard line, where they failed in eight attempts to put it across. The Freshman lacked coordination and failed to show their usual power. Selden at centre, and Taylor at quarterback for the seconds played well.

The Freshman teams A and B also had a long signal drill and scrimmage.
